DoubleZero is a global network of high-performance links designed for blockchain and distributed systems. It offers low-latency routing to enhance validator performance and enable faster, fairer participation. 2Z Tokens provide access to the network’s services and reward contributors based on performance and reliability. They can also be staked to boost network security.

Hedera Hashgraph isn’t built on top of a conventional blockchain. Instead, it introduces a completely novel type of distributed ledger technology known as a Hashgraph. This technology allows it to improve upon many blockchain-based alternatives in several key areas, including speed, cost, and scalability.
